The Beautiful Beach on Okinawa Honto

Mibaru is a beach located near Nanjo city in the south-east of Okinawa Island, the main island of the subtropical archipelago in Japan. It is the best beach easily reachable from Naha.

Finding a beach in Okinawa is not a challenge per se, but finding a good and nice beach might prove difficult and requires some preparation. Many beaches are semi-private and belong to resorts, others are so noisy that dolce far niente is out of the question. Beach-goers thus usually prefer enjoying smaller islands off to Okinawa (such as Zamami), with isolated beaches that are much quieter.

Beautiful beaches on Okinawa Honto (mainland) are not only scarce, but they are scattered across the island, incurring potential long car travels. Thus there is about a hundred kilometers between Okuma, JAL airlines famous private resort located in the north, and Naha. Naha beach is not even to be considered as it is just a bunch of sand under a freeway without any view on the ocean!

Mibaru is the best beach quickly accessible from Naha. With a 1 kilometer long shoreline, its most beautiful part is set close to its entrance, in an area gathering several activities for visitors. Water sports are favored, with sea kayak, windsurfing and glass-bottom boat rides.

The beach can also be enjoyed sunbathing while admiring the paradise-like landscape of Mibaru. Nature has provided a large range of rocks formations, home to a beautiful flora and fauna, on the sand as well as under water.

Review this place
4.5/5 (2 votes)
Kanpai's opinion

Mibaru photo gallery

  • Okinawa, Mibaru Beach
  • Okinawa, Mibaru Beach 2
  • Okinawa, A boat and rock formations on Mibaru Beach
  • Okinawa, Mibaru sand beach and rock formations
  • Okinawa, Mibaru Beach 3
  • Okinawa, Mibaru Beach 4
  • Okinawa, Mibaru Beach 5
  • Okinawa, Wooden Pier at Mibaru Beach
  • Okinawa, Rock Formations at Mibaru Beach
  • Okinawa, Rock Formations at Mibaru Beach 2
  • Okinawa, Rock Formations at Mibaru Beach 3
  • Okinawa, Rock Formations at Mibaru Beach 4
  • Okinawa, Coral fragment on Mibaru Beach
  • Okinawa, Flower on Mibaru Beach


Use Google Maps
Enlarge map
View the whole map of Japan

How to get to Mibaru

By bus -- about 45 minutes from Naha, stop at "Mibaru Beach Iriguchi" then 3 minutes on foot.

By car -- about 40 minutes on the highway. Address: 1599-6 Hyakuna, Tamagusuku, Nanjo city.

Location unreachable with the JR Pass

Get there with a rental car



  • Parking fee: ¥500 (~US$ 4.70)
  • Shower: ¥300 (~US$ 2.80)
  • Coin locker: ¥200 (~US$ 1.90)
  • Glass-bottom boat ride: ¥1,650 (~US$ 15.60) per adult, ¥880 (~US$ 8.30) per child

Get your Japanese Yens free of charge

Opening hours

Beach always open

Every day:

  • Supervised swimming from 9 a.m. to 6 p.m.
  • Restaurants from 10 a.m. to 3:30 p.m.
  • Shops from 8:30 a.m. to 5:30 p.m.

How long / when to visit

Marine activities from the end of April to September

In Japanese

新原ビーチ (Mibaru beach)

Weather in Okinawa

28 / 30°C
27 / 30°C

Internet connection

Stay connected with a Pocket Wifi in Japan

Related topics


Official Website (in Japanese)



Ask a question

Travel Companions


Search for companions

Day trips from Mibaru (Okinawa)